Position Title: Underground Utility/Pipe Superintendent
Location: Portland, OR
Salary: $140,000- $180,000 Bonus(s)
Employment Type: Full-Time Employee

Job Summary:

This leading general contractor is seeking a skilled and experienced Underground Utility/Pipe Superintendent to oversee the installation and maintenance of underground utility systems and piping for their construction projects.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in managing underground utility projects, excellent leadership abilities, and a deep understanding of industry standards and safety regulations. This role is crucial for ensuring the successful execution of projects from start to finish.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Supervise and coordinate all activities related to the installation and maintenance of underground utilities and piping systems, including water, sewer, storm drains, and other infrastructure.
  • Manage daily operations on job sites, ensuring work is completed safely, efficiently, and to the highest quality standards.
  • Oversee and direct field crews, subcontractors, and equipment, providing guidance and support as needed.
  • Ensure compliance with all safety regulations, construction codes, and company policies.
  • Review project plans, specifications, and schedules to ensure accurate execution and timely completion of work.
  • Conduct regular site inspections to monitor progress, identify potential issues, and implement corrective actions as necessary.
  •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and other stakeholders to resolve any problems and ensure project requirements are met.
  • Maintain accurate project documentation, including daily reports, work logs, and safety records.
  • Manage inventory and procurement of materials and equipment required for the projects.
  • Foster a positive work environment and promote teamwork and effective communication among all project personnel.

Experience Needed:

  • Minimum of 5-7 years of experience in supervising underground utility and piping projects, including experience with water, sewer, storm drains, and related systems.
  • Proven track record of successfully managing projects from inception to completion.
  • Strong understanding of underground utility installation methods, materials, and industry regulations.
  • Experience in managing field crews and coordinating with subcontractors and suppliers.
  • Familiarity with construction safety practices and regulatory requirements.

Qualifications Needed:

  • High school diploma or equivalent; technical or vocational training in construction or a related field preferred.
  • Relevant certifications (e.g., OSHA certification, Heavy Equipment Operator License) are a plus.
  • Strong leadership, organizational, and problem-solving skills.
  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word) and familiarity with project management software.
  • Ability to read and interpret construction plans and specifications.
  • Valid driver's license and ability to travel to job sites within the Portland, OR area.
